The 'King of Bling' has arrived! Russian tycoon moors his incredible £225million bombproof superyacht on the Thames













The £225million ship, built for Russian billionaire Andrey Melnichenko, is currently turning heads in London after Tower Bridge was raised so it could cruise up the Thames and moor alongside the museum ship HMS Belfast. His wife, Aleksandra, pictured, said she had a vital role in designing the interior of the luxury yacht, which features a main cabin that can only be accessed by fingerprint scanner. The floating palace has about twenty times the living space of the average house with three swimming pools and an area to land a helicopter. Yet, running the massive yacht requires the reserves of an Oligarch as filling the vessel with fuel costs a staggering £375,000.
